Hiking is one of the park’s main attractions, with trails to suit every skill level. For those seeking a leisurely stroll, the Park Avenue trail offers a relatively flat and short journey that still delivers incredible views of towering cliffs and unique rock formations.

For more experienced hikers, the challenging Delicate Arch trail rewards with one of the most iconic views in the entire park.

Mountain biking enthusiasts find their nirvana in Moab Park, dubbed the “Mountain Biking Capital of the World.” The park boasts a myriad of biking trails, from the beginner-friendly Bar-M Loop to the infamous Slickrock Bike Trail, known for its challenging terrain and thrilling descents.

The natural beauty surrounding these trails adds an extra layer of thrill, making each ride an unforgettable experience.

For thrill-seekers wishing to explore Moab Park from a different perspective, rock climbing and canyoneering offer an exhilarating challenge. The park’s unique sandstone cliffs provide climbing routes of varying difficulty, ideal for both beginners and seasoned climbers. Canyoneering, a blend of hiking, scrambling, rappelling, and sometimes swimming, provides an adventurous way to explore the park’s hidden canyons and mesmerizing landscapes.
